VR-Hut, Waterloo’s first VR experience. A whole new world at your fingertips. 

The first virtual reality center VR-Hut officially opened its doors in late October in Waterloo. This new attraction, perfect for celebrating a birthday or organizing a team-building event, offers a whole range of experiences. 

Among the dozens of scenarios available, players can become archers and must work together to defend a city, form teams and relive famous battles from World War II, escape from a variety of virtual escape rooms, enjoy an unforgettable experience that transports them high above the ground atop an 80-story building, or—for younger players—engage in games of speed and logic. 




Multiplayer VR gaming

Although everyone has their own headset, the activity is still a group experience. In fact, VR-Hut offers a multiplayer experience that allows multiple people to connect to the same game and interact with one another. Up to 10 people can connect at the same time within VR-Hut.

“What’s incredible is that we see every day that people who hate video games love VR just as much as gamers do,” explains Arnaud Percy, co-founder of VR-Hut.

Two additional openings in Belgium in 2019… and three abroad.

At the helm of this project is Arnaud Percy. The co-founder of Belwatech immediately recognized the real potential of virtual reality: “In our industry, where technology is becoming an increasingly integral part of our daily lives at an ever-faster pace, we need to be pioneers and keep an open mind. “When I first tried a game with a virtual reality headset, I quickly realized that this was the future of gaming.” 

Arnaud Percy plans to expand the VR-Hut concept to other cities very soon. In fact, Brussels and La Louvière are on the list.“We’re looking for locations for April 2019.”VR-Hut also has international ambitions, through franchises, particularly in Switzerland, Morocco, and Réunion.
